#682c9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#682c9c is composed of 40.8% red, 17.3%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 272.1 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 39.2%. #682c9c color hex could be obtained by blending #d058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#682c9c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#682c9c has RGB values of R:104, G:44,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 6827164.

Shades and Tints of #682c9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f7f3fc is the lightest one.
